Medical records are vital to your attorney’s ability to build a strong case for your child’s claim. They provide evidence that your medical provider breached their duty of care to you and your child by failing to exercise the level of skill, knowledge, and caution that a reasonable medical professional would have in similar circumstances. They also show how your medical provider’s negligence caused your child’s injuries.
Your lawyer will also need to identify the appropriate defendants in your case. This will depend on who was involved in the delivery and what types of treatment you received following the birth. Typically, the hospital and the doctors that provided your medical care will be named as defendants. In some cases, a midwife or other non-physician medical professional will be included as a defendant.
In addition to identifying the defendants in your case, your attorney will need to identify the specific injuries your child suffered. This will involve working with medical experts to evaluate the medical evidence and determine whether your child’s injuries are directly related to your medical provider’s negligence.
The expert’s opinion will be used to support your attorney’s legal arguments and build a persuasive case for your child’s claim. This can include written reports and onsite testimonies.
Once your attorney has sufficient proof of the elements of a medical malpractice claim, they will file a lawsuit in court. They will also prepare for trial if the medical providers’ insurance companies fail to offer a fair settlement.
Your lawyer will need to understand how your child’s injuries will impact his or her life to accurately calculate the amount of compensation you should receive. This may include medical expenses, the cost of medical equipment and home modifications, as well as ongoing therapy costs.

Expert Witnesses
In a medical malpractice case, your attorney may need to work with experts to review the case evidence and help you establish that a medical professional breached their duty of care. These experts are generally medical professionals who can provide a formal opinion on the matter based on their knowledge of your case and its facts. They can also be called to testify at trial if necessary.

To win a lawsuit, it must be proven that the doctor or hospital in question failed to adhere to a standard of care, which is defined as “the level of quality and care that a reasonably prudent health care provider would provide under similar circumstances.” A birth injury attorney will help you gather evidence and identify policies, protocols, and procedures that may have been violated. They will also consult expert witnesses who can provide opinions on what was and wasn’t acceptable medical care under the circumstances.
If a pre-trial settlement cannot be reached, your case will go to trial. A skilled trial attorney will present a compelling argument using professionally crafted exhibits and expert testimony. They will be able to demonstrate that you and your child have suffered a variety of losses that warrant compensation, including economic damages such as past and future medical bills, and non-economic damages such as pain and suffering. In more egregious cases, juries can award punitive damages designed to punish the defendants for their negligence or reckless behavior.
